SQL 특징

CODEDRAGON Development/Database

반응형

 

 

SQL 특징

·       데이터베이스를 사용할 , 데이터베이스에 접근할 있는 데이터베이스 하부 언어입니다.

·       단순히 검색만을 위한 데이터 질의어(Query Language) 아니라, 데이터 정의 기능과 조작 위한 데이터 정의어(DDL), 데이터 조작어(DML), 데이터 제어어(DCL) 기능을 모두 제공하는 종합적인 DB 언어 입니다.

·       관계 데이터 모델의 데이터 연산 언어인 관계 대수와 관계 해석을 기초로 하는 고급 데이터 언어

·       데이터 연산에 대한 처리 과정은 명시하지 않고, 데이터 연산의 결과만을 명시하는 비절차적 언어 , 선언적 언어이므로, 사용자 편의 중심의 언어

·       장치 독립적이고 액세스 경로에 대해서는 어떠한 참조도 하지 않습니다.

·       레코드의 집합인 테이블 단위로 연산을 수행합니다.

·       사용방법이나 문법은 다른 언어(C, C#, Java)보다 단순하고 쉽습니다.

·       SQL 표준화로 인해 상용 관계 DBMS 간의 전환이 용이

·       단말기(Terminal)에서 단독으로 대화식 질의어로 사용

·       자바, C/C++ 등으로 개발된 응용 프로그램에 삽입해서 사용

·       개개의 레코드(튜플) 단위로 처리하기 보다는 레코드의 집합 단위로 처리

·       릴레이션, 튜플, 속성 등과 같은 관계 데이터 모델의 공식 용어 대신, 테이블, , 같은 일반적인 용어를 사용

·       영어 문장과 비슷한 구문을 갖추고 있기 때문에 초보자들도 비교적 쉽게 사용할 있습니다.

·       대소문자를 구별하지 않지만 데이터의 내용은 구별합니다.

 


반응형

'Development > Database' 카테고리의 다른 글

프로시저 삭제  (0) 2019.06.02
DBMS 연동 도식도  (0) 2019.05.26
EDW(Enterprise Data Warehouse)  (0) 2019.05.12
트랜잭션(Transaction), 트랜잭션의 단위  (0) 2019.05.05
SQL 자습서  (0) 2019.04.28